Couple Arrested For Child Trafficking In Oyo State

























             The Nigeria Police Force, Oyo State Command, yesterday paraded a man and his wife for using young girls as próstitutes under the pretence of getting jobs for them.
            The suspects, Falusi Temilola, 45, and his wife Falusi Helen, 43, were said to have held four victims hostage at Sharp Corner Hotels, Orita Aperin area of Ibadan where they used them for próstitution and fattened their pockets.
The state Police public relations officer, DSP Olabisi Clet-Ilobanafor gave the names of the victims as Endurance Erabor (15), Jessica John (25), Princess Igbinedion (17), and Tina Nosa (20), all from Benin City in Edo State.
           She said, “The criminal investigation department of the police received information about a girl who was said to have been brought from Benin for próstitution but refused to be séxually abused.
“When they got there, they discovered that it was true and
that there were other three young girls working in the hotel as próstitutes. We discovered that the people behind this are Mr and Mrs Falusi.
“When interrogated, the girls told us that they came to Ibadan due to loss of parents and lack of help which prompted them to search for greener pastures. They said the woman told them that she had a beer parlour and would bring them to work as attendants only for them to discover that they will be working as próstitutes.
DSP Clet-Ilobanafor said the Police, on the completion of their investigation, shall charge the suspects to court while the young ladies shall be rehabilitated through the intervention of agencies like NAPTIP. She advised young girls to be wary of people who always promise to get them jobs.
In another development, an unidentified man has attacked some members of the Calvary Church, Ayekale-Agugu, Ibadan during a vigil on February 26, 2014.
The DSP disclosed that the suspect, now at large, attacked Rev Oladimeji and his wife and two girls identified as Anu and Kausara Isiaka with machete at about 2am that fateful day.
She said Kausara died due to severe injuries she sustained during the attack while the remaining victims were recuperating at an undisclosed hospital.
The police gathered from the pastor that Kausara got converted from Islam to Christianity, a situation which displeased her father, Mr Isiaka who had threatened to deal with the girl. The police has arrested Mr Isiaka for interrogations.
